18+ months into a global pandemic and the ground is still heavily shifting in the enrollment field. While many planned to return to “normal” with high school visits and travel this fall, the Delta variant is suddenly upending those plans. These cutting edge panelists will talk about new initiatives they’re working on for this fall recruitment season, including augmented reality, as well as other emerging trends they’re seeing in the field.

Allison Turcio, Assistant Vice President for Enrollment and Marketing, Siena College

Allison Turcio is Assistant Vice President for Enrollment and Marketing at Siena College. She leads college-wide marketing, market research, and enrollment communications efforts. Her work has won numerous awards and has been presented at the American Marketing Association’s Symposium for the Marketing of Higher Education and other conferences. Allison was selected for the Albany Business Review 40 Under 40 and Siena College’s Excellence in Administration award in 2020. She is working on her doctorate degree at Northeastern University and holds a master’s in Communications and bachelor’s in English.

Gil Rogers, Executive Vice President, PlatformQ Education

Gil Rogers is a recognized leader in enrollment management and marketing. Prior to consulting in edtech and marketing, Gil served in numerous enrollment marketing roles at the University of Hartford and the University of New Haven. Prior to his role at PlatformQ Education, Gil was the Director of Marketing at Chegg Enrollment Services where he led the development of their approach that combined digital marketing with lead generation which was later incorporated in to NRCCUA’s suite of services (later acquired by ACT). At PlatformQ Education Gil supports the development and execution of online engagement strategies and plans with a focus on conversion and enrollment yield.

José Mallabo Chief Marketing/Revenue Officer and VP of Marketing Communications & Admissions at Morehouse College

José Mallabo is a seasoned multi-channel marketing and communications professional with 30 years of U.S. and international experience. He has proven success in driving awareness, corporate reputation and demand generation for Fortune 200 companies, early stage companies, and in higher education.

He is currently Chief Marketing/Revenue Officer and Vice President of Marketing Communications and Admissions at Morehouse College in Atlanta where he oversees a team of 30 and sits on the President’s cabinet. Over his career he has worked with organizations such as Hewlett Packard, FedEx, Xerox, Kodak, eBay, LinkedIn, Savannah College of Art & Design (SCAD), and GSI Commerce.

At eBay Inc. he led corporate and financial communications globally and rebranded the company’s online classifieds properties around the world into eBay Classifieds Group. José lead international corporate communications at LinkedIn where he launched operations in Mumbai, Sydney, Toronto, and Amsterdam. He has also held senior-level positions within agencies such as Ketchum Public Relations and Text 100 Public Relations

José entered higher education in 2013 as Senior Vice President of Marketing and PR at SCAD where he reorganized several functions into one global team on four campuses focused on three priorities: recruitment, reputation, and rankings. During his time at SCAD, demand generation grew by 140% and expanded its reach into new markets in the U.S. and internationally through initiatives such as SCADpad.

He has also co-founded Vireo Labs, an education technology company focused on streamlining enrollment engagement for students and colleges; and also served as a startup catalyst for ATDC (Advanced Technology Development Center of the Georgia Institute of Technology) where he coached entrepreneurs on Learn Startup methodology.

José earned his masters of science degree in mass communications from San Diego State University and a bachelor of arts degree in communications from La Salle University. He also holds certificates in user experience research and front end web development.
